What voters choose may not be what they get.
This has become especially clear in Suffolk.
In 1993, the county's citizens chose to limit county elected officials to three four-year terms. Last week, a local judge ruled that under the state constitution, three of six countywide elected positions were beyond the reach of that referendum.
